Background
The Humulus lupulus and the Elapidae belong to the vertebrate subgenus, have Lepidoptera in the class of Reptilia, and are mainly distributed in the south region of China, live in plains and mountainous regions or Hongling regions, or can be distributed in mountainous regions with the altitude of 2000 meters, are national secondary protection animals, are listed as endangered species in Chinese animal Red book, and are also listed as endangered animals by the International trade convention on endangered wild animals and plants. The Luffa hydropiper is also called as a mouse snake and a south snake, and is a nontoxic snake. Cobra, also known as King-shovel snake and blowing snake, is a poisonous snake. The snake meat is rich in nutrition, has high edible value, and contains nearly 20 amino acids, multiple vitamins and abundant trace elements. Snake venom, snake gall, snake slough, snake skin, snake meat, snake blood, snake penis and the like are well-known traditional Chinese medicinal materials and have obvious curative effects on rheumatism and rheumatoid diseases of a movement system, neuralgia of various nervous systems, tuberculosis of various types, skin diseases, inflammatory diseases and the like. The water-law snakes and cobras are high-value economic snakes which are popular in the market. Lupulus polyphylla and cobra are succulent snakes, and mainly feed on rats, toads, frogs, lizards, birds and other snakes in nature.
Originally, artificially-bred snakes mainly use fresh chilled rats, chickens, frogs and the like as feed. These fresh feeds have drawbacks: (1) the fresh bait carries pathogenic bacteria, parasites and the like, so that the incidence rate of snakes is high; (2) the nutrient components are single, unstable and uncontrollable; (3) the stable supply cannot be ensured due to the limitation of seasonal climate, feed source and storage and transportation conditions; (4) long growth period of the snakes, high breeding cost and the like.
With the development of the breeding industry of snakes, the artificial snake breeding feed is gradually developed and popularized. The traditional artificial breeding snake feed is prepared by the following raw material formula: 30-50 parts of chicken, 10-25 parts of duck meat, 2-8 parts of pork, 0.5-1.5 parts of rat meat, 15-25 parts of frog meat, 2-5 parts of milk powder, 10-25 parts of eggs, 4-8 parts of shrimp heads, 3-8 parts of earthworms, 2-7 parts of kelp, 0.1-0.3 part of cucumber seed powder, 2-6 parts of cottonseed powder, 2-7 parts of cod-liver oil, 0.5-2 parts of calcium gluconate, 0.1-0.5 part of phagostimulant and 10-15 parts of water. The young snake feed combining Chinese medicine and Western medicine is produced with animal meat and other animal meat, including earthworm, insect and its larva, fish, frog, lizard, bird and rabbit, wheat bran, fish meal, blood powder, boiled water, egg liquid, soybean powder, vitamin B complex, terramycin and Chinese medicinal liquid, and through four steps of material selection, material pre-treatment, material mixing, feed forming and storage. However, these traditional snake feeds have poor palatability and low feeding rate when fed, which is not conducive to rapid breeding of snakes.

The embodiment of the invention also provides a method for breeding snakes, which comprises the following steps: feeding snake feed to a snake breeding house, wherein the snake feed comprises the feed composition.
According to the method for breeding the snakes, the feeding mode can be flexible and changeable. The feed composition may be used for feeding in its entirety, or may be mixed with conventional feed (e.g., ice fresh feed) for feeding. When fed in admixture with conventional feed, the amount of the admixed feed composition may be gradually increased until the conventional feed is completely replaced with the feed composition described above. It is also possible to use the feed composition during certain periods of cultivation and to use conventional feed in other cultivations.
Preferably, the number of feeding of the snake feed is 1 or 2.
Preferably, the feeding amount of the snake feed is 1/10-1/6 of the quality of the snake. It can be understood that the feeding amount is scientific, the feeding amounts of snakes with different sizes are different, and the feeding amount can be adjusted according to the situation.
Preferably, the temperature of the culture room is controlled to be 28-30 ℃.
Preferably, the breeding density of the snakes in the breeding house is 10-60 snakes/m3. The breeding density can be moderately changed according to the size of the snakes, such as: 60 small snakes per square meter, 20 medium snakes per square meter and 10 large snakes per square meter.

Example 1
The embodiment provides a feed composition, which comprises the following raw material formula: each kilogram of the feed composition comprises 800g of chicken, 100g of frog meat and 100g of premix; each kilogram of the premix comprises vitamin A7500IU, vitamin D3000 IU, vitamin E100 IU and vitamin K31000IU, vitamin C300 mg, vitamin B210mg of vitamin B620.0mg of vitamin B120.1mg, pantothenic acid 48mg, niacinamide 90.0mg, folic acid 3.7mg, D-biotin 0.2mg, inositol 60mg, MgSO4·7H2O 20mg、NaCl 20mg、KI 0.6mg、ZnSO4·7H2O 4mg、MnSO4·4H2O2.5mg、CuCl22mg、CoCl2·6H2O 0.15mg、FeSO4·7H2O 4mg、KH2PO4·H2O 2250mg、CaCO3400mg, and the blood meal and the fish meal in a mass ratio of 5: 1.
The preparation method of the feed composition comprises the following steps:
firstly, unfreezing frozen chicken skeleton meat and frog meat, and mincing into muddy meat by a meat mincer;
secondly, fully mixing the meat paste and the premix;
thirdly, preparing the cylindrical pellet feed by a forming machine, and storing the pellet feed at the temperature of 18 ℃ below zero for standby.
The cobra is bred by using the feed composition, and the breeding method comprises but is not limited to the following steps:
1. the cobra bred artificially is placed into a constant-temperature snake room (28-30 ℃), and the optimal breeding density is 60 small snake seedlings per square meter.
2. The medicine is used for killing parasites of cobra firstly, and then regulating intestines and stomach of the cobra to prevent and treat gastroenteritis.
3. Domestication management is carried out on the cobras, the domestication management comprises feeding time management, feed management, feeding mode management and feeding amount management, and domestication of the cobras is completed, and the specific method comprises the following steps:
(1) the first day of feeding time is 1 time from 8 am to 6 pm, the mass of the fed feed is one eighth of the weight of the snake (two thirds of the traditional fresh frozen bait and one third of the feed composition of the embodiment), and the feed composition is washed by clear water before feeding so as to be fully thawed and put in drinking water.
(2) On the next day, the method is repeated for the first day, the amount is reduced properly, and sufficient drinking water is put in.
(3) On the third day, the feeding method is repeated on the first day, the amount is reduced appropriately, and sufficient drinking water is put in.
(4) And stopping feeding the feed for 2 days in the fourth and fifth days, and only enough drinking water is put in the feed.
(5) Repeating the method of the first day on the sixth day, the seventh day and the eighth day, only gradually reducing the amount of the traditional fresh ice bait and sufficiently placing drinking water.
(6) Stopping feeding the feed for 2 days on the ninth day and the tenth day, and only adding drinking water.
(7) Repeating the method of the first day on the eleventh day, the twelfth day and the thirteenth day, only feeding the artificial compound feed without mixing the traditional fresh ice materials, sufficiently feeding drinking water, and finishing the domestication.
(8) The feed composition of the embodiment is completely adopted for cultivation until 12-16 months.
